博客 跨云迁移技术:高效数据迁移策略与实现方法

跨云迁移技术:高效数据迁移策略与实现方法

   数栈君   发表于 2026-01-07 17:51  80  0

跨云遷移技術:高效數據遷移策略與實現方法

在當今數字化轉型的浪潮中,企業正在積極探索如何更高效地管理和利用數據。數據中台、數字孿生和數字可視化等技術的興起,進一步推動了企業對數據遷移的需求。然而,隨著云計算的普及,企業可能面臨多云或混合云環境的需求,這就需要進行跨云遷移。跨云遷移是指將數據、應用程序或資源從一個云平臺遷移到另一個云平臺的過程。本文將深入探討跨云遷移的技術細節、策略和實現方法,幫助企業更好地完成數據遷移。


一、跨云遷移的重要性

在當今的數字化轉型中,企業可能出于以下原因進行跨云遷移:

  1. 成本優化:不同云平臺的價格策略不同,企業可能希望通過遷移到成本更低的云平臺來節省開支。
  2. 性能提升:某些云平臺在特定地區或特定業務場景下性能更佳,企業可能需要遷移到性能更優的云平臺。
  3. 避免鎖定:過度依賴某一家云平臺可能帶來鎖定風險,跨云遷移可以帮助企業降低這種風險。
  4. 業務擴展:隨著業務的發展,企業可能需要遷移到支持更大規模或更多功能的云平臺。

跨云遷移的順利完成,直接影響到企業的業務連續性和數據安全性。因此,制定高效的數據遷移策略至關重要。


二、跨云遷移的關鍵挑戰

在進行跨云遷移時,企業可能面臨以下挑戰:

  1. 數據一致性:數據在遷移過程中可能因網絡延遲或中斷而丟失或損壞,確保數據一致性是遷移的核心難題。
  2. 網絡性能:跨云遷移通常涉及大規模數據傳輸,網絡性能直接影響遷移速度和效率。
  3. 遷移風險:遷移過程中可能出現不可預知的錯誤,例如數據丟失、服務中斷或應用程序崩潰。
  4. 遷移成本:遷移過程中的帶寬費用、工具費用和人工成本可能超出企業預算。

為了解決這些挑戰,企業需要制定詳細的遷移計劃,并選擇合適的工具和方法。


三、跨云遷移的核心策略

1. 數據評估與分類

在遷移之前,企業需要對數據進行全面評估和分類。數據可以分為以下幾類:

  • 結構化數據:例如數據庫中的表結構數據。
  • 非結構化數據:例如文檔、圖像、音視頻等。
  • 敏感數據:例如客戶信息、財務數據等,需要特別注意安全性。

數據評估的目的是確定哪些數據需要遷移,哪些數據可以保留或刪除。此外,還需要評估數據的大小、格式和存儲位置,以便選擇合適的遷移工具和方法。

2. 選擇合適的遷移工具

目前市場上提供了多種跨云遷移工具,企業需要根據自身需求選擇合適的工具。常見的遷移工具有:

  • 云平臺提供的遷移工具:例如AWS Transfer Family、Azure Migrate等。
  • 第三方遷移工具:例如CloudSync、Datapipeline等。
  • 自研遷移工具:企業可以根據自身需求開發定制化的遷移工具。

在選擇遷移工具時,企業需要考慮工具的穩定性、遷移速度、支持的數據類型以及是否支持多云環境。

3. 網絡架構優化

網絡性能是影響遷移效率的重要因素。企業可以采取以下措施來優化網絡架構:

  • 使用高帶寬網絡:確保遷移過程中網絡帶寬足夠,避免因帶寬不足導致遷移速度慢。
  • 優化數據傳輸路徑:選擇最短的數據傳輸路徑,降低網絡延遲。
  • 使用 CDN 技術:如果數據量巨大,可以考慮使用 CDN(內容分發網絡)來加速數據傳輸。

4. 數據一致性保障

數據一致性是跨云遷移的核心挑戰之一。企業可以采取以下措施來保障數據一致性:

  • 使用數據校驗工具:在遷移前后使用數據校驗工具對數據進行校驗,確保數據完整性。
  • 使用分布式鎖定機制:在遷移過程中,使用分布式鎖定機制來防止數據沖突。
  • 分段遷移:將數據分段遷移,每段遷移完成后進行數據校驗,確保每段數據的完整性。

5. 遷移風險控制

在遷移過程中,企業需要采取措施來降低風險。常見的風險控制措施包括:

  • 制定應急計劃:在遷移過程中,制定應急計劃以應對可能的突發事件。
  • 進行模擬遷移:在正式遷移之前,進行模擬遷移,評估遷移計劃的可行性。
  • 使用回滾機制:在遷移完成后,保留原云平臺的數據,以便在遷移出現問題時可以及時回滾。

6. 遷移后的優化

遷移完成后,企業需要對數據進行優化。常見的優化措施包括:

  • 數據清理:刪除冗余數據和無用數據,降低存儲成本。
  • 數據壓縮:對數據進行壓縮,降低存儲空間占用。
  • 數據分片:將數據分片存儲,提高數據訪問效率。

四、跨云遷移的實現方法

1. 數據傳輸協議

數據傳輸是跨云遷移的核心環節。常見的數據傳輸協議包括:

  • FTP(文件傳輸协议):常用于小規模數據傳輸。
  • SFTP(安全文件傳輸协议):支持加密傳輸,適合敏感數據。
  • SCP(安全コピー协议):基于SSH的數據傳輸协议,適合小規模數據。
  • HTTP/HTTPS:常用于大規模數據傳輸,支持流媒體傳輸。

在選擇傳輸協議時,企業需要考慮數據的安全性、傳輸速度和兼容性。

2. 數據壓縮與加密

數據壓縮和加密是數據遷移中常見的技術。數據壓縮可以降低數據量,加快遷移速度;數據加密可以保障數據安全性。

  • 數據壓縮:常見的數據壓縮算法包括gzip、bzip2等。
  • 數據加密:常見的加密算法包括AES、RSA等。

3. 帶寬管理

在遷移過程中,企業需要合理管理帶寬,避免因帶寬不足導致遷移速度慢。常見的帶寬管理措施包括:

  • 分段傳輸:將數據分段傳輸,避免一次性傳輸大量數據。
  • 優先級傳輸:根據數據的重要性設置傳輸優先級。
  • 帶寬限流:設置帶寬限流,避免影響其他業務。

4. 數據校驗

數據校驗是保障數據一致性的重要措施。常見的數據校驗方法包括:

  • CRC校驗:使用CRC校驗算法對數據進行校驗。
  • 哈希校驗:使用哈希算法(例如MD5、SHA-1)對數據進行校驗。
  • 數據比對:在遷移前后對數據進行比對,確保數據一致性。

5. 遷移工具的使用

遷移工具是跨云遷移的核心工具。企業可以根據自身需求選擇合適的遷移工具。常見的遷移工具有:

  • AWS Transfer Family:支持將數據從本地或其他云平臺遷移到AWS。
  • Azure Migrate:支持將數據從本地或其他云平臺遷移到Azure。
  • Google Cloud Transfer:支持將數據從本地或其他云平臺遷移到Google Cloud。

五、跨云遷移的成功案例

以下是一個跨云遷移的成功案例:

某金融機構由于業務發展需要,決定將其數據從本地數據庫遷移到云數據庫。在遷移過程中,該機構采用了以下策略:

  1. 數據評估與分類:對數據進行全面評估和分類,確定需要遷移的數據。
  2. 選擇遷移工具:選擇了AWS Transfer Family作為遷移工具。
  3. 網絡架構優化:使用高帶寬網絡和優化的數據傳輸路徑,確保遷移速度。
  4. 數據一致性保障:使用數據校驗工具對數據進行校驗,確保數據一致性。
  5. 遷移風險控制:制定了應急計劃,并進行了模擬遷移,評估遷移計劃的可行性。

最終,該機構順利完成了數據遷移,實現了業務的連續性和數據的安全性。


六、跨云遷移的未來趨勢

隨著云計算的進一步普及,跨云遷移將成為企業數據管理的常態。未來,跨云遷移將呈現以下趨勢:

  1. 智能化遷移:人工智能和機器學習技術將被應用到遷移過程中,實現智能化遷移。
  2. 自動化遷移:遷移工具將更加智能化,實現遷移過程的自動化。
  3. 多云管理:企業將更加重視多云管理,實現不同云平臺之間的數據同步和資源共享。
  4. 邊緣計算:邊緣計算將被應用到遷移過程中,實現數據的就近存儲和處理。

七、廣告文字&鏈接

申請試用

申請試用

申請試用


跨云遷移是一項復雜但必要的技術,企業需要根據自身需求選擇合適的策略和工具。希望本文能為企業提供有益的參考,幫助企業順利完成數據遷移。如需進一步了解相關信息,歡迎訪問DTStack申請試用。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料